What is MVP Health Care?

MVP Health Care is a not-for-profit health insurance company serving New York and Vermont. They offer a range of plans, from individual and family coverage to employer-sponsored plans, catering to diverse needs and budgets. Their focus on community health and commitment to quality care sets them apart in a competitive market. Unlike some for-profit insurers, their profits are reinvested into improving healthcare services and benefits for their members.

What types of plans does MVP offer in NY?

MVP offers a variety of plans under the Affordable Care Act (ACA), commonly referred to as Obamacare. These include:

  • Bronze Plans: These plans have the lowest monthly premiums but require higher out-of-pocket costs when you need care.
  • Silver Plans: They offer a balance between premium costs and out-of-pocket expenses. Many qualify for cost-sharing reductions (subsidies) to make them more affordable.
  • Gold Plans: These plans have higher monthly premiums but lower out-of-pocket costs compared to Bronze and Silver plans.
  • Platinum Plans: These offer the highest level of coverage and the lowest out-of-pocket costs, but come with the highest monthly premiums.

Beyond these ACA plans, MVP also provides other health insurance options, such as Medicare Advantage and Medicaid plans, depending on your eligibility. It’s crucial to explore all options to find the best fit for your circumstances.

Does MVP Health Insurance cover pre-existing conditions in NY?

Yes. Under the Affordable Care Act, MVP Health Insurance, like all other ACA-compliant plans in New York, cannot deny coverage or charge higher premiums due to pre-existing conditions. This means individuals with health conditions like asthma, diabetes, or heart disease can obtain coverage without fear of discrimination. This is a significant protection for many New Yorkers.

What is MVP's network of doctors and hospitals in NY?

MVP maintains a vast network of doctors, specialists, and hospitals throughout New York. The specific providers in your network will depend on the plan you choose. Before enrolling, it's essential to verify that your preferred doctors and hospitals are included in the plan's network to avoid unexpected out-of-network costs. Their website typically provides a search tool to check provider availability.

How much does MVP health insurance cost in NY?

The cost of MVP health insurance in New York varies significantly depending on several factors, including:

  • Plan type: Bronze plans are generally the cheapest, while Platinum plans are the most expensive.
  • Age: Older individuals typically pay higher premiums.
  • Location: Premiums can vary based on your geographic location within New York.
  • Family size: Premiums for family plans will be higher than those for individual plans.
  • Income: Your income level may impact your eligibility for government subsidies that lower your premium costs.

To obtain a precise cost estimate, you'll need to use MVP's online tools or contact them directly.

How do I apply for MVP health insurance in NY?

You can apply for MVP health insurance through several avenues:

  • Online: MVP's website provides a user-friendly online application process.
  • Phone: You can contact their customer service representatives for assistance with the application process.
  • In-person: You may be able to apply in person through authorized brokers or agents.

Applying during the annual open enrollment period usually guarantees the smoothest process.
